IMS 5.0 (FMC3.1) IMS 6.1 (FMC4.0)• The performance of the SPDF (PCS-5000 V3.1) has been
increased • The performance of the P/I/S – CSCF and HSS measured in the
load tests (TM) FMC4.0 with HCM activated has reached the IMS5.0 values
• The performance of the HiQ4200 R13 FP1 measured in the load tests (TM) FMC4.0 with HCM activated has reached the HiQ4200 R12 values
• The performance of the BGW is the same as for FMC3.1• The EtE performance of the IMS6.1 configuration based on the
OSP HW deployment can serve appr. 400 000 subs according to the FT TM. The first bottleneck in this configuration is the BGW.

Deltas between FMC 4.x/IMS 6.x and FMC 3.x/IMS 5.xPCS-5000 V3.1
IMS 5.0/FMC3.1 (PCS-5000 V2.5) IMS 6.1/FMC4.0 (PCS-5000 V3.1) SPDF functionality• 1400 msg/s 2600 msg/s• 70 130 CAPS
assuming 20 messages (call setup and release) average per half call (challenged INVITE) at the Gq, Ia interfaces
• 120 000 parallel sessions
IMS6.2/FMC4.2 (PCS-5000 V3.3) (expected):• 3000 msg/s

Deltas between FMC 4.x/IMS 6.x and FMC 3.x/IMS 5.xBGW ACME Net-Net 4250
IMS 5.0 (FMC3.1) IMS 6.1(FMC4.0)• 250 tps (80% CPU)• 62 CAPS
assuming 4 transactions (call setup and release, orig.+term.) in average per half call (challenged INVITE) at the Ia interfaces
• 30 000 parallel calls, 15 000 in case of NATRemark:
In FMC4.2 a new BGW HW Net-Net 4500 with higher performance will be released
Load B (90%) Load A (80%)
HA QoS 345 tps/86 CAPS 307 tps/76 CAPSHA non QoS 407 tps/101
CAPS362/90 CAPS

P-CSCFIMS 6.1 (FMC4.0)/IMS 6.2 (FMC4.2)
Residential IP Centrex Remark
Active* IMS subscribers Static limit
740 000 280 000 According to FT TM (see TRD A4.1V9)
Active* IMS subscribers
Dynamic limit
900 000 180 000 According to FT TM (see TRD A4.1V9)
CAPS 450 450 Load B. Only Voice calls
Initial Registrations/s 630 630 Load B. Only registration traffic
Re-registrations/s 1410 1410 Load B. Only registration traffic
* An active IMS subscriber is an subscriber who is provisioned in the HSS and, at a given moment in time, is actively using at least one IMS service, which he/she has subscribed for.
